BTY Korbel is pretty versatile with what rubbers you put on it. If you want control, classic rubbers like Sriver work well. If you want faster rubbers, the newer rubbers like Genius or Outlaw feel really good as well. With that said, I actually didn't really like Tenergy 05 on it. Especially after hearing so many positive reviews and recommendations of Korbel/T05, I was quite disappointed. But that's just imho...

The Best rubbers for Petr Korbel is T05 on FH and T05fx on BH! I Also use this combo on my virtuoso+ the difference between the two rubbers make fast speed and provide good spin and superb control.
Primorac off- and P.Korbel are the two best allwood blade on the market (BTY)
btw.
For me OSP has better control,feeling and handles.
V+ is similar in speed
anyway Tenergy05 for P.Korbel thats my suggestion....
